Output 4d12ed52657d74524cc4eaf4d0c63ad306b5e336fee8fba761ee8aacc11e6efb:24

value
586942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9dfef29950de8c816f860c6024e5a8884a47ec2 OP_EQUAL
address
3HBEPBk7CrYqQHn2FUKA1fCYfsqXjvTWU9
transaction
4d12ed52657d74524cc4eaf4d0c63ad306b5e336fee8fba761ee8aacc11e6efb
spent
true